Cut-Out Relays Solid State
1926-1957 Harley-Davidson generators have three carbon brushes and do not need a regulator. Instead, on all these years Harley-Davidson equipped their motorcycles with cut-out relays that open the circuit from generator to battery to avoid the battery from being discharged unvoluntarily. Mechanical relays do have their flaws and need maintenance. So here is our selection of solid state diode equipped devices that offer the same functionality but much more reliability. Unless you lift off the cover you won't see any difference to stock equipment.

Delco Relay Style Regulator 6V
When upgrading your old hog with a more powerful 2-brush generator there is always the problem, where to mount the larger regulator that is required with them. Here is an easy solution: a fully electronic regulator which mounts at the same spot as your early cut-out relay and which even fits under your small Delco Remy cover. Problem solved.
